UK Michael Jackson Tribute Acts: Man In The Mirror

  • 13 years ago
http://www.tributebandreviews.co.uk - 'Man In The Mirror' presents the ultimate Michael Jackson tribute show including flawless live vocals, great costumes and amazing dance routines. This act is taking the UK by storm.

Recommended